Transaction 2ab62ab927009dea0a620f6aa21c2ddf0bb68da12ca8ab3172435086641ae2ae
1 Input
1 Output
-
2ab62ab927009dea0a620f6aa21c2ddf0bb68da12ca8ab3172435086641ae2ae:0
- value
- 628967
- script pubkey
- OP_0 OP_PUSHBYTES_20 b6a272e0987b905e025f09fd73b2cce69828436f
- address
- bc1qk6389cyc0wg9uqjlp87h8vkvu6vzssm0tkzp7e